#086195 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#086195 is composed of 3.1% red, 38%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.6%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 202.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 30.8%. #086195 color hex could be obtained by blending #10c2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#086195 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#086195 has RGB values of R:8, G:97,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 549269.

Shades and Tints of #086195
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ecf8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#086195
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a5053 is the less saturated color, while #02639b is the most saturated one.
